About the Provider

Description: MS. PECOLA'S FAMILY DAY CARE HOME is a Three Star Family CC Home License in CHARLOTTE NC, with a maximum capacity of 8 children. The home-based daycare service helps with children in the age range of 0 through 12. The provider also participates in a subsidized child care program.

Inspection/Report History

Where possible, ChildcareCenter provides inspection reports as a service to families. This information is deemed reliable, but is not guaranteed. We encourage families to contact the daycare provider directly with any questions or concerns, as the provider may have already addressed some or all issues. Reports can also be verified with your local daycare licensing office.

Date Type Violations Rule
2024-02-20 Unannounced Inspection No
2023-05-25 Unannounced Inspection Yes
2023-05-25 Violation 706 .1719 (a)(7)
Corrosive agents, pesticides, bleaches, detergents, cleansers, polishes, and products under pressure in an aerosol dispenser and any substance that may be hazardous to a child if ingested, inhaled, or handled were not kept in locked storage when children were in care. I observed n aerosol can of fire fighting foam underneath the kitchen sink, not locked and accessible to children.
2023-05-25 Violation 1301 GS 110-91(11); 10A NCAC 09 .1705(b)(5)
Operator did not complete the required number of on-going training hours as specified in rule. The provider did not receive the required number of on-going training hours.
2023-05-25 Violation 1718 .1712(e )(6)
The written plan of care was not given and explained to parents of children in care on or before the first day the child attended the home. Parents did not sign a statement acknowledging the receipt and explanation of the plan. Parents did not give written permission for their child to be transported by the operator for specific routine tasks that are included on the written schedule. One children's file did not have documentation that the written plan of care signed statement.
2023-05-25 Violation 2023 .1703(d)(2)
Operator and/or staff who work with children, did not complete health and safety training as part of on-going training so that every five years, all the topic areas were covered. The provider did not complete the health and safety training every five years as required.
2023-05-25 Violation 2031 .1726(b)&(c)
Operator did not provide a copy of the shaken baby syndrome and abusive head trauma policy to parents at time of enrollment, and / or within fourteen days of a changes to the policy. One children's file did not have documentation that the shaken baby syndrome and abusive head trauma policy was signed by the parent at the time of enrollment.
2023-02-09 Unannounced Inspection Yes
2023-02-09 Violation 508 .1703(a)(2)
Operator did not successfully complete a first aid course as referenced in Rule.1702(b)(2) First aid training was not renewed on or before the expiration of the certification. Provider's First Aid expired on 1/27/22.
2023-02-09 Violation 511 .1703(a)(3)
Operator did not successfully complete a CPR course as referenced in Rule.1702(b)(2) CPR training was not renewed on or before the expiration of the certification. Provider's CPR expired on 1/27/22.
2023-02-09 Violation 716 10A NCAC .1719(a)(27)
Electrical outlets not in use were not covered. The power strip cord did not have safety covers for the outlets that were not in use.
2022-06-01 Unannounced Inspection Yes
2022-06-01 Violation 2031 .1726(b)&(c)
Operator did not provide a copy of the shaken baby syndrome and abusive head trauma policy to parents at time of enrollment, and / or within fourteen days of a changes to the policy. Three out of three children's records that were monitored today did not have a copy of the shaken baby syndrome and abusive head trauma policy.
2022-06-01 Violation 702 .1719 (a) (1)
Potentially hazardous items, including but not limited to, power tools, nails, chemicals, propane stoves, lawn mowers, and gasoline or kerosene, whether or not intended for use by children were not stored in locked areas, removed from the premises, or otherwise inaccessible to children. I observed power tools in the garage where the children enter and exist the facility. The power tools were not stored in a locked area and were accessible to children.
2022-06-01 Violation 716 10A NCAC .1719(a)(27)
Electrical outlets not in use were not covered. I observed two electrical outlets that were not in use in the power strip that did not have safety covers.
